American Cemetery

On Saturday (March 22) we drove to the American Cemetery in Metro-Manila. These are graves of approximately 17,000 American soldiers killed during WWII in the Philippines, and on the walls are the lists of 36,000 names whose remains have not been found. Row upon row upon row -- young men, dead. Sobering.
